What Exactly Is a Plumbing Emergency?
A plumbing emergency is any sudden, unexpected problem with your water or sewer system that poses an immediate threat to your property, health, or safety. It’s not just a minor drip you can catch with a bucket. It’s a situation that needs a professional emergency plumber in George West right away to prevent major damage. If you’re wondering “is this bad enough to call someone now?” it probably is.
What Are Common Plumbing Emergencies in George West?
Here are the big problems we see most often in our area:
- Burst or Frozen Pipes: During a rare but hard winter freeze in George West, water inside pipes can expand and cause them to burst, often inside walls or under slab foundations common in many Texas homes.
- Sewer Line Backups: Heavy rains or shifting soil in our region can cause tree roots to invade older sewer lines or cause a blockage, leading to nasty sewage backing up into drains or toilets.
- Major Leaks & Flooding: A broken water heater, a supply line that gives way under the sink, or a failed washing machine hose can flood a room fast, risking damage to floors and walls.
- Complete Loss of Water Pressure: If every faucet suddenly goes dry, you might have a major break in your main supply line—a serious issue that needs immediate attention.
- Gas Line Leaks (if you have gas appliances): If you smell rotten eggs or hear hissing near a gas line, leave the house and call for help immediately. This is a dangerous emergency.
If any of these are happening in your home, it’s time to call an emergency plumber.
When Should I Call an Emergency Plumber vs. When Can I Wait?
Knowing the difference can save you stress and money.
Call RIGHT NOW (24/7) if:
- You have no water at all.
- Sewage is coming up into sinks, tubs, or toilets.
- You have a major leak you can’t stop with a shut-off valve.
- You suspect a frozen pipe that may burst.
- You smell natural gas.
- Water is causing immediate damage to ceilings, walls, or floors.
It can likely wait until normal business hours if:
- A faucet has a small, slow drip.
- A toilet is running constantly but not overflowing.
- A drain is slow but not completely clogged.
- Your water heater is making odd noises but still providing warm water.

How Much Does an Emergency Plumber Cost in George West?
This is one of the most common questions we get: “How much is an emergency plumber call-out?” and “Do emergency plumbers cost more?” Let’s break it down honestly.
Yes, emergency plumbing services typically cost more than a scheduled appointment. Why? Because you’re paying for immediate availability, priority dispatch, and after-hours labor. Here’s a general cost breakdown for our area:
- Emergency Call-Out/Service Fee: This covers the trip to your home, usually between $79 - $129. This is your first cost.
- Hourly Labor Rate: After-hours labor is billed at a higher rate, often $150 - $250 per hour, depending on the time (nights, weekends, holidays).
- Parts & Materials: Any new pipes, fittings, valves, etc., needed for the repair.
- Potential Additional Costs: For big jobs like a sewer line repair or extensive pipe replacement, the total can be higher.
So, how much emergency plumber cost for common issues?
- Stopping a major leak and replacing a valve: $200 - $500
- Clearing a severe sewer blockage: $300 - $800
- Repairing a burst section of pipe: $400 - $1,000+
- Replacing a failed water heater: $1,200 - $2,000

How to Get an Emergency Plumber & What to Do Until We Arrive
When disaster strikes, stay calm and follow these steps:
- Shut Off the Water: Find your main water shut-off valve (often near the water meter or where the main line enters the house) and turn it off. This stops the flow and limits damage.
- Turn Off Electric/Gas (if safe): If water is near electrical outlets or appliances, turn off power at the breaker. If you smell gas, evacuate first.

- Contain the Mess: Use towels, buckets, and mops to contain standing water.
- Clear a Path: Move any furniture or rugs from the area so your plumber has easy access.
While you wait, don’t try DIY fixes that could make things worse. Let the professionals handle it.
